FAQ: Sweepling orphaned-resource sweeper

Q: Sweepling stopped deleting stale volumes — why?

A: Usually its state store is sealed after a node restart. Check the sweep log, confirm the last checkpoint, and unseal before re-running. Do not force-delete manually; Sweepling reconciles on next pass. Unsealing the state store requires the recovery passphrase, which is recorded directly below.

unlock words, hafop-tahog: drumir-druiel-kasox-wenax-tamys-frair

## Limits & Quotas: Tarnwick DNS Flakiness

The Tarnwick edge resolvers intermittently time out when the Opaline control plane rotates zone data, producing sporadic SERVFAIL bursts lasting under two minutes. On-call should not restart resolvers during a burst; the client-side cache and retry quotas below are sized to absorb it. Exceeding these quotas pages the platform rotation instead. The enforced limits are recorded here for reference.

tuning table, yajog-yahof:
BUDGETS = {
    "lamvan": 303,
    "wenox": 460,
    "fenvan": 525,
}

## Changelog — keyspin v2.4.0

Changed defaults. Rotation interval dropped from 90 to 30 days. Grace window for old secrets is now 48 hours, down from 7 days. Dry-run mode is off by default; pass the flag explicitly if you want it. New hires: keyspin runs on the Veldt cluster and rotates everything tagged `managed`. Nothing else changed. If a rotation fails twice, page the owning team, not platform. The current defaults are listed below.

service settings:
PRAIX_LOG_LEVEL=error
PRAIX_METRICS_HOST=metrics.praix.qorvelcorp.corp
PRAIX_POOL_SIZE=16